Output f8b1a910598da8c80188c6f07059acd74c5a1de384e3d2d7bad552e557fbe1f2:12

value
605478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 990b9c79db51f3f17c2403047d77f1cbcc9454fa OP_EQUAL
address
3FeFDf2mw9wtGKqGzmY7Md4HE9Vq4RMsjx
transaction
f8b1a910598da8c80188c6f07059acd74c5a1de384e3d2d7bad552e557fbe1f2
spent
true